Anthropology of an American Girl - Hilary Thayer Hamann

This big book about the life and relationships of an American girl carried a review quote comparing it to crack, which I didn't initially give too much thought to beyond thinking that it meant the book was hard to put down. The more I read, the more seriously I took the claim, however - in a way I can't quite put my finger on, I found this novel both compulsive and disturbing, even a little unsavoury. If the aim of the book was to convey the powerful irrationality of love and longing, then I suppose it did so effectively, but despite my total immersion in the book while I was reading it, I didn't feel very connected to any of the characters, or really believe in their relationships or situations.
